Stay Warm, Catch the Ball: Your Guide to Cold Weather Football Gloves
Football season is awesome! But playing in the cold can be tough. Your hands get stiff and it’s hard to catch the ball. Cold weather football gloves are made to help. They keep your hands warm and give you a better grip. This guide will help you pick the best pair.
Key Features to Look For
You need to find gloves that work well. Here are some important things to think about:
- Grip: The gloves need a good grip. Look for gloves with sticky palms. This helps you catch the ball.
- Warmth: Your hands need to stay warm. Look for gloves with insulation. Thicker gloves are usually warmer.
- Fit: The gloves should fit snugly. They shouldn’t be too loose or too tight. Measure your hand to find the right size.
- Wrist Support: Some gloves have wrist straps. These help keep the gloves in place. They can also support your wrist.
- Durability: Football is a rough sport. The gloves should be tough. Look for gloves made with strong materials.
Important Materials
The materials used in the gloves make a big difference. Here are some important materials:
- Insulation: This is what keeps your hands warm. Common insulation materials include fleece, Thinsulate, and other synthetic materials.
- Palm Material: The palm is where you catch the ball. Look for materials like silicone or rubber for a good grip.
- Back of Hand Material: This part protects the back of your hand. It can be made of different materials like nylon or spandex. They help with flexibility.

User Experience and Use Cases
Think about how you will use the gloves.
- Playing Position: A receiver needs a great grip. A lineman might need more protection.
- Weather Conditions: If it is very cold and wet, you need warm, waterproof gloves.
- Practice vs. Games: You might want different gloves for practice and games.
- Comfort: The gloves should feel comfortable. You will be wearing them for a long time.
